Man Dies After Becoming Pinned Under Tractor In Suffolk: Police

The tractor rolled backward and struck him, police say.

COMMACK, NY— A man died after becoming pinned under a tractor in Commack Tuesday afternoon, police said.

According to Suffolk County police, the incident took place on Veterans Memorial Highway at 4:42 p.m.

Abdelmontalab Sati, 62, of Amsterdam, NY, exited a 2023 International tractor and walked behind the rear of the vehicle, which then rolled backward and struck him, police said.

Sati was found unconscious with his legs pinned under the vehicle, police said.

Detectives are investigating what time the incident occurred, police said.

Sati was transported to St. Catherine of Siena Medical Center in Smithtown, where he was pronounced dead, police said.

Detectives are asking anyone with information to contact Fourth Squad detectives at 631-854-8452.
